Droid Grids Beta 0.17.4 Released

Posted by glider521al - January 17th, 2011


I've significantly updated the game and it's available here (I DELETED the old one):

NEW FEATURES:

CLOAKING IS NOW AN ARMOUR ABILITY:
Drawing inspiration from halo. A meter on the right of your HUD show's how much power you have when engaging this ability. Once the power depletes to zero, you'll need to wait
till it recharges to a certain level (icon will glow) before you can engage it again

DIFFICULTY CURVE SIGNIFICANTLY CHANGED:
Users complained that the game was too hard to begin with and they would get swarmed by enemies within the first 5 minutes of gameplay. To address this I've:

* Added a more gradual difficulty curve with a system of rounds and waves:
Each round enemies become more agressive, more varied, more numerous and will sometimes have upgraded speed and combat capabilities.
Currently 3 waves make up a round (but that will change when I add more enemies in the future)

* Limited the number of enemies that can stalk you around the map:
This feature took over a week of programming (on/off) to get right and prevents players from getting swarmed by a ridiculous number of enemies on the field.

This limit increases each round.

NEW CREDITS SYSTEM:
Credits are earned by destroying enemies.

Turrets ports can now be unlocked by spending Credits at them:
-400 Credits to unlock a turret port
-50 Credits to Respawn a turret

MISCELLANEOUS:

* Fixed glitch with enemies standing stupid if they stand where you were 3 seconds ago.

* Optimized code for custom controls
Remember that if the fire & strafe keys are the same for 1st/2nd player,
than the controls in Co-Op defaults to:
L: Strafe (1st player) Shift: Strafe (2nd player)
Enter: Fire (1st player) Space: Shoot (2nd Player)
